Overview

Breakwater Beach is a beautiful and popular beach located in Brewster, United States The beach is approximately 1,000 feet long with soft, white sand that is perfect for sunbathing or building sandcastles

Amenities

Breakwater Beach has many amenities including bathroom access, outdoor showers, and lifeguards on duty during the summer months

Activities

activities available at the beach include swimming, surfing, boogie boarding, and fishing.

Parking

There is a parking lot available at Breakwater Beach, and parking is free for residents of Brewster with a beach parking sticker. Non-residents can purchase a daily pass for $20 or a weekly pass for $75.

Fun Fact

Fun fact: Breakwater Beach is known for its large and unique rock formations that create a natural breakwater along the shore.

Attractions

In addition to the beach, there are several attractions in the area surrounding Breakwater Beach. The Cape Cod Museum of Natural History is just a short drive away, and the Cape Cod Rail Trail is a popular biking trail that runs through Brewster. The nearby Nickerson State Park offers hiking trails, fishing ponds, and campsites.

Restaurants

There are several great restaurants near Breakwater Beach. The Brewster Fish House is a local favorite, serving up fresh seafood dishes with a French twist. The Bramble Inn & Restaurant offers elegant fine dining with a farm-to-table menu featuring local ingredients. For a more casual meal, check out Guapo's Tortilla Shack for delicious Mexican cuisine.

Hotels

There are also several hotels in the area if you're looking for a place to stay. The Candleberry Inn is a beautiful bed and breakfast with cozy rooms and a charming garden. The Ocean Edge Resort & Golf Club offers luxurious accommodations and a variety of amenities, including a spa, golf course, and tennis courts. The Villages at Ocean Edge Resort & Golf Club offers more affordable options with access to the resort's amenities.
